Sex refers to physical and biological traits—whereas gender refers especially to social or cultural traits—and the physiological and psychological processes related to procreation and sexual pleasure Sexuality is the capacity to derive pleasure from various forms of sexual activity and behavior, particularly from sexual intercourse.
